Brazil became the second team to qualify for 2022 World Cup playoffs after defeating Switzerland thanks to the late goal by Casimiro.

World Cup 2022

Brazil - Switzerland 1:0 (0:0)
Goals: Casimiro, 83 (1:0)

Brazil: Alisson; Alex Sandro (Telles, 86); Thiago Silva; Militão; Marquinhos; Casimiro; Paqueta (Rodrygo, 46); Fred (Bruno Guimarães, 58); Raphinha (Antony M., 73); Vinícius Júnior; Richarlison (Gabriel Jesus, 73)
Bench: Weverton; Ederson; Daniel Alves; Danilo; Fabinho; Bremer; Ribeiro E.; Pedro Ab.; Martinelli
Yellow Cards: Fred 52

Switzerland: Sommer; Elvedi; Rodriguez; Rieder Fa. (Steffen, 59); Widmer (Frei F., 86); Akanji; Xhaka; Sow Dj. (Aebischer, 76); Freuler; Embolo (Seferovic, 76); Vargas (Edimilson Fernandes, 59)
Bench: Omlin; Kobel; Köhn; Cömert; Schär; Shaqiri X.; Zakaria D.; Jasari; Fassnacht
Yellow Cards: Rieder Fa. 50
